Abstract

336,001. Grote, E. R. July 9, 1929. Fluid-friction apparatus.-The inlet and outlet ports of a molecular pump are formed parallel to the axis of rotation of the rotating member. As shown in Fig. 1 the operating chamber is formed by two grooves C, C<1> in a casing b across each of which is formed a radial partition and which are connected in series by a cavity f. The grooves may also be connected in parallel. The inlet port e opens into the groove C and the outlet e<1> from the groove C<1>. As shown in Fig. 4 the rotating member comprises two discs a<3>, a<4> the peripheries a<5>, a<6> of which are flared to form a narrow slit. The gas enters through a port j, passes through holes i in the disc a<3> and enters a space g between the discs. Thence it passes through the slit and out through the port k.
